Why Local Window Installers Matter
Selecting local window installers offers a number of benefits over bigger, nationwide companies. Local installers are usually more knowledgeable about regional climate conditions and building regulations, supplying important insights distinct to your area. Additionally, they frequently rely on word-of-mouth and reputation, guaranteeing a higher level of responsibility and client service.
Advantages of Hiring Local Window Installers
Personalized Service: Local installers tend to supply a more customized service. They typically make the effort to understand your particular requirements and choices.

Quick Response Times: Being close-by ways that local companies can respond to inquiries and service calls a lot more rapidly than their national counterparts.

Understanding of Local Regulations: Local experts understand the specific building regulations and regulations pertinent to your area, reducing the risk of hold-ups and additional expenses connected to compliance.

Neighborhood Support: Employing local businesses keeps money in the community, supporting jobs and promoting local financial development.

Referrals and Reviews: Local companies often have a network of satisfied customers, making it much easier to find reputable referrals.

Research Local Companies: Ask good friends and next-door neighbors for suggestions, and check online review platforms like Yelp or Google Reviews for insights.

Get Multiple Estimates: Don't opt for the first quote. Getting at least 3 estimates will provide a clearer photo of market rates.

Check Credentials: Ensure that the installer is licensed, bonded, and insured. This protects you from any liability in case of accidents.

Request for References: Learning from previous customers' experiences can assist assess the installer's reliability and workmanship.

Review Contracts Thoroughly: Before signing, reviewed all agreements in detail. Make sure that all elements of the job, including timelines and expenses, are clearly specified.

Interact Clearly: Make sure your selected installer comprehends your vision. Clear interaction helps prevent misconceptions and safeguards your interests.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. What should be the typical cost of window installation?
The cost can differ extensively based upon window types, sizes, and installation intricacies. Usually, house owners can anticipate to pay anywhere from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,000 per window, consisting of both products and installation.
2. For how long does window installation take?
The time needed varies based upon the variety of windows being set up and the complexity of the job. Generally, an entire project can take anywhere from a few hours to numerous days.
3. What types of windows are best for energy performance?
Energy-efficient windows, such as double-glazed or triple-glazed windows, are popular options. Look for windows with a low U-factor and a low Solar Heat Gain Coefficient (SHGC).
4. Can I install windows myself?
While DIY window installation is an option for convenient house owners, it's not generally suggested. Poor installation can lead to concerns like water leakage, drafts, and minimized energy efficiency.
5. What's consisted of in a typical quote from a local installer?
A typical estimate must include the cost of products, labor, any preparation work needed, and a breakdown of any extra expenses.
